=== Plugin Name === Contributors: studiopress, nathanrice, bgardner, dreamwhisper, laurenmancke, shannonsans, modernnerd, marksabbath, damiencarbery, helgatheviking, littlerchicken, tiagohillebrandt, wpmuguru, michaelbeil, norcross, rafaltomal Tags: social media, social networking, social profiles Requires at least: 4.0 Tested up to: 5.4 Stable tag: 3.0.2 This plugin allows you to insert social icons in any widget area. == Description == Simple Social Icons is an easy to use, customizable way to display icons that link visitors to your various social profiles. With it, you can easily choose which profiles to link to, customize the color and size of your icons, as well as align them to the left, center, or right, all from the widget form (no settings page necessary!). *Note: The simple_social_default_glyphs filter has been deprecated from this plugin. == Installation == 1. Upload the entire simple-social-icons folder to the /wp-content/plugins/ directory 1. Activate the plugin through the 'Plugins' menu in WordPress 1. In your Widgets menu, simply drag the widget labeled "Simple Social Icons" into a widget area. 1. Configure the widget by choosing a title, icon size and color, and the URLs to your various social profiles. == Frequently Asked Questions == = Can I reorder the icons? = Yes, icons can be reordered with the use of a filter. See: https://github.com/copyblogger/simple-social-icons/wiki/Reorder-icons-in-version-2.0 = Can I add an icon? = Yes, icons can be added with the use of a filter. Understanding the Mechanics and Risks

At its heart, the aviator game revolves around a plane that takes off, and with it, a multiplying coefficient. Players place a bet before each round, and their potential winnings increase as the plane climbs higher and the multiplier grows. However, the plane can crash at any moment, and if it does, the player loses their entire bet. The key is to cash out before the plane disappears, securing a profit based on the multiplier at the time of withdrawal. This fundamental risk-reward dynamic is what defines the game and keeps players engaged. Successful play requires a careful assessment of probabilities and a cool head under pressure. The unpredictable nature of the ‘crash’ introduces a significant element of chance, meaning even the most skilled players can experience losses.

The sophistication of the random number generators (RNGs) used in the aviator game is critical to its fairness and appeal. Reputable platforms employ provably fair systems, allowing players to verify the integrity of each round and ensuring transparency. Understanding how these RNGs work, though not essential to gameplay, can provide peace of mind to players concerned about the randomness of the outcome. The volatility of the game is also a key consideration. Higher volatility means larger potential payouts, but also a greater risk of losing your bet quickly. Conversely, lower volatility offers more frequent, but smaller, wins. Choosing a strategy that aligns with your risk tolerance is crucial for long-term enjoyment and sustainable gameplay.

Strategies for Playing

While the aviator game is fundamentally based on chance, certain strategies can help to manage risk and increase your chances of winning. One common approach is the Martingale system, where you double your bet after each loss to recoup previous losses and make a profit. However, this strategy requires a substantial bankroll and can quickly lead to significant losses if you encounter a string of unlucky rounds. Another strategy is to set target profit goals and cash out when you reach them, regardless of the multiplier. This helps to avoid greed and protect your winnings. Disciplined bankroll management is arguably the most important skill in this game, as it allows you to weather losing streaks and continue playing when the odds are in your favor.

Furthermore, observing patterns and utilizing auto-cashout features can be beneficial. Some players analyze previous round results, looking for trends in the plane’s flight duration, although it's important to remember that each round is independent and past performance is not indicative of future results. Auto-cashout allows you to pre-set a desired multiplier, and the game will automatically cash out your bet when the multiplier reaches that level, removing the pressure of manual timing. However, relying solely on these tools is not a foolproof strategy, and skillful manual play remains essential for maximizing your potential winnings.

Beyond the Game: Responsible Gambling and Support

While the aviator game is designed to be an entertaining pastime, it’s vital to remember the importance of responsible gambling. The thrill of potential winnings can be addictive, and it’s crucial to maintain control and avoid chasing losses. Setting limits on your spending and playing time, and sticking to those limits, are essential steps in preventing problem gambling. Recognizing the signs of gambling addiction – such as spending more than you can afford, lying to others about your gambling habits, or feeling restless or irritable when trying to cut back – is equally important.

Numerous resources are available to support those struggling with gambling addiction. Organizations like the National Council on Problem Gambling and Gamblers Anonymous offer confidential support, counseling, and self-exclusion programs. Remember, seeking help is a sign of strength, and there are people who care and want to help you regain control.
